Louisiana State University Department of Textiles, Apparel Design, & Merchandising The department houses the LSU Textile and Costume Museum.

Textiles and apparel play an important role in everyone’s daily life – from clothing to the textiles that surround us in our homes, cars, businesses, public spaces, and even in the outdoors – and in the global economy.
